For those considering a move to Milwaukee, the Southgate neighborhood offers a warm and welcoming community with a charming blend of residential comfort and local attractions. Situated in the southeast part of Milwaukee, Southgate is known for its friendly atmosphere and convenient access to essential amenities. Residents here enjoy a mix of quaint shops, cozy cafes, and beautiful parks that provide plenty of opportunities for outdoor activities and relaxation. One of the standout features of Southgate is the nearby Southgate Park, which is perfect for families and individuals who love spending time outdoors, with walking trails, playgrounds, and picnic spots.

One of the biggest draws of Southgate is how close it is to Downtown Milwaukee, making it an ideal location for commuters and those who want to enjoy the city’s vibrant cultural scene without living in the hustle and bustle. Downtown is just a short drive away, meaning you can easily catch a Brewers game at American Family Field, explore the Milwaukee Art Museum, or enjoy a night out at one of the many theaters and restaurants. Despite its proximity to the city center, Southgate still maintains a peaceful, neighborhood feel, which is perfect for families and professionals alike who are looking for a quieter place to call home.

When it comes to everyday conveniences, Southgate doesn’t disappoint. The neighborhood boasts easy access to local grocery stores, quaint eateries, and service providers, making day-to-day living straightforward and stress-free. For those who appreciate community events, Southgate often hosts neighborhood gatherings and seasonal festivals that foster a strong sense of connection among residents. Whether you’re a young professional, a family with children, or someone looking to settle down in a friendly neighborhood with easy access to Milwaukee’s best, Southgate offers a great balance of suburban charm and city convenience.

Housing trends offer valuable insight into the accessibility and character of a neighborhood. In Southgate, the median home price is $164,300, which is less than many surrounding areas. This affordability makes it an attractive option for first-time buyers, young families, or anyone looking to enter the housing market without a significant financial barrier. Looking at appreciation rates and past market trends in Southgate can offer valuable insight into the neighborhood’s investment potential. Understanding how home values have changed over time helps buyers gauge future growth, assess long-term stability, and make more informed real estate decisions.

The median rent is around $955, which is on par with many comparable neighborhoods. This balanced pricing offers a mix of affordability and value, making it a practical choice for a wide range of renters.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the overall lifestyle like?

Southgate in Milwaukee offers a relaxed, suburban lifestyle with convenient access to urban amenities. Residents enjoy a balance of quiet neighborhood living and proximity to shopping centers like Southgate Mall, as well as parks such as Grant Park along Lake Michigan. The area is family-friendly, with a focus on community and outdoor activities.

Are there any community events or local gatherings throughout the year?

Yes, Southgate hosts several community events that bring neighbors together, including seasonal festivals and local markets. Nearby, the South Shore Farmers Market and events at the South Milwaukee Performing Arts Center provide cultural and social opportunities. Additionally, Grant Park often features outdoor concerts and nature programs that are popular among residents.

Are there major highways or transit lines nearby?

Southgate is well-connected with major highways such as Interstate 94 and Interstate 794 nearby, providing easy access to downtown Milwaukee and surrounding areas. Public transit options include Milwaukee County Transit System bus routes that service the neighborhood, making commuting convenient for residents without a car.
